In 2023, the Total Internal R&D Personnel in Agriculture, Forestry, and Fishing in Italy stood at 515.4 full-time equivalents (FTEs). Forecasted growth indicates an increase to 542.7 FTEs in 2024, with a steady rise reaching 661.8 FTEs by 2028. Analyzing year-on-year variations, there is a consistent growth pattern: 5.65% from 2024 to 2025, 5.26% from 2025 to 2026, 4.87% from 2026 to 2027, and 4.56% from 2027 to 2028. The compound annual growth rate (CAGR) for the five-year period is projected at 5.10%.
